Plan International seeks an Education Technical Advisor to provide high-level technical leadership for the ASEANUK SAGE Phase II Programme. The role involves shaping and supporting national and regional education systems to improve foundational learning, inclusion, and evidence-based education policy across Southeast Asia.

Responsibilities

  • Provide technical leadership on foundational learning, designing and assuring high-quality interventions grounded in global evidence and early-grade learning best practice.
  • Offer specialist technical assistance to Ministries of Education and partners on pedagogy, assessment, inclusion, and the effective use of EdTech and AI for learning.
  • Strengthen evidence use and research uptake, translating data (including SEAPLM) into policy recommendations, tools, and guidance.
  • Lead policy dialogue with ASEAN bodies, SEAMEO, national institutions, and development partners to align with regional education priorities.
  • Facilitate regional knowledge exchange, communities of practice, and cross-country learning to scale effective approaches.
  • Ensure quality, compliance, safeguarding, and value for money in all technical deliverables, supporting adaptive management and donor engagement.
